Convenient Location
Located just 1.6 miles south of Dumfries, Holiday Inn Dumfries offers easy access to local attractions like Sweetheart Abbey and Threave Castle.
Comfortable Accommodation
Each spacious room at Holiday Inn Dumfries provides a view of the vibrant garden, along with modern amenities such as a flat-screen TV, tea/coffee facilities, and a work desk. The en suite bathroom ensures a relaxing stay with a bath, shower, and complimentary toiletries.
Culinary Delights
Indulge in a variety of dishes made from locally-sourced ingredients at the on-site restaurant, or enjoy a coffee or cocktail at the Elizabeth Lounge. The full bar menu, featuring a range of malt whiskies, adds to the dining experience.

A deposit may be required at the property.
Free public parking is possible on site (reservation is not needed).
Pets are allowed on request. Charges may be applicable.
WiFi is available in all areas and is free of charge.
Children of any age are allowed.
Children up to and including 2 years old stay for free when using an available cot.
Children up to and including 17 years old stay for free when using an existing bed.
You haven't added any extra beds.
Any type of extra bed or child's cot/crib is upon request and needs to be confirmed by management.
When booking more than 6 rooms, different policies and additional supplements may apply.
